跟ssd相关的linux命令
-
在Linux操作系统中,有一些与SSD(固态硬盘)相关的命令可以帮助我们管理和优化SSD的性能。下面是一些常用的SSD相关的Linux命令:
1. fdisk:这个命令用于分区硬盘。对于SSD来说,我们可以使用fdisk命令来创建分区并对分区进行管理。
2. hdparm:这个命令用于设置和检查IDE接口设备的参数。我们可以使用hdparm命令来优化SSD的性能,例如启用TRIM命令、禁用写缓存等。
3. fstrim:这个命令用于从文件系统中删除无用的数据。在SSD上,使用fstrim命令可以通知SSD清理不再使用的数据块,从而提高SSD的性能和寿命。
4. smartctl:这个命令用于监控硬盘的状态和性能。我们可以使用smartctl命令来检查SSD的健康状况,并获取关于SSD的详细信息。
5. iostat:这个命令用于监控系统的I/O性能。通过使用iostat命令,我们可以查看SSD的I/O负载情况,以及SSD的读写速度等信息。
6. blktrace:这个命令用于跟踪块设备的I/O操作。通过使用blktrace命令,我们可以详细地了解SSD的读写过程和性能表现。
7. sysctl:这个命令用于在运行时调整内核参数。我们可以使用sysctl命令来优化SSD的性能,例如调整I/O调度算法、启用SSD的电源管理等。
以上是一些常用的与SSD相关的Linux命令,通过使用这些命令,我们可以更好地管理和优化SSD的性能,提高系统的响应速度和稳定性。
2年前 -
1. df命令:df命令用于显示文件系统的磁盘空间使用情况,包括每个文件系统的总空间、已使用空间、可用空间以及挂载点等信息。通过df命令可以查看SSD磁盘的使用情况。
2. du命令:du命令用于查看文件或目录的磁盘使用情况。可以通过指定du命令的参数来查看SSD磁盘上的文件或目录占用的磁盘空间。
3. fdisk命令:fdisk命令用于创建和管理磁盘分区。可以使用fdisk命令对SSD磁盘进行分区操作,例如创建新的分区、删除分区、查看分区等。
4. mkfs命令:mkfs命令用于创建文件系统。可以使用mkfs命令将SSD磁盘的分区格式化为指定的文件系统类型,例如ext4、NTFS等。
5. mount命令:mount命令用于挂载文件系统到指定的挂载点。可以使用mount命令将格式化好的SSD磁盘分区挂载到指定的目录上,以便系统可以访问该文件系统。
6. umount命令:umount命令用于卸载已挂载的文件系统。在使用SSD磁盘上的文件系统之后,可以使用umount命令将其卸载,以便安全地从系统中移除。
7. fstrim命令:fstrim命令用于对文件系统进行TRIM操作。TRIM是一种SSD优化技术,可以提高SSD的性能和寿命。通过fstrim命令可以向SSD发送TRIM命令,以清空已删除文件的空间。
8. hdparm命令:hdparm命令用于配置和管理ATA硬盘驱动器参数。对于支持TRIM的SSD,可以使用hdparm命令来检查和配置SSD的TRIM状态。
9. smartctl命令:smartctl命令用于监控和控制S.M.A.R.T(Self-Monitoring, Analysis, and Reporting Technology)功能。通过smartctl命令可以检查SSD的健康状况和性能。
10. iostat命令:iostat命令用于监控系统的IO性能。可以使用iostat命令来查看SSD的读写速度、IO等待等信息,以便及时调整系统配置。
2年前 -
在Linux系统中,有一些与SSD(Solid State Drive,固态硬盘)相关的命令,用于管理和优化SSD的使用。以下是与SSD相关的一些常用Linux命令和操作流程。
1. 查看SSD信息
可以使用以下命令查看SSD的信息。
“`
sudo hdparm -I /dev/sdX
“`
其中,`/dev/sdX`代表SSD的设备文件路径,例如`/dev/sda`。2. 启用TRIM
TRIM是一种用于优化SSD性能和寿命的命令。您可以使用以下命令启用TRIM。
“`
sudo systemctl enable fstrim.timer
“`
然后,计划任务将在规定的时间间隔内自动运行TRIM命令来优化SSD。3. 优化文件系统
文件系统的配置也可以对SSD的性能和寿命产生影响。以下是一些常用的命令用于优化文件系统。3.1. ext4文件系统
对于使用ext4文件系统的SSD,您可以在挂载时使用`discard`选项来启用TRIM。
“`
sudo vi /etc/fstab
“`
在`/etc/fstab`文件中,找到SSD的挂载选项,并添加`discard`选项。
“`
/dev/sdX /mnt/ssd ext4 discard,defaults 0 0
“`
然后保存并退出文件,重启系统。3.2. btrfs文件系统
对于使用btrfs文件系统的SSD,可以通过以下命令来启用实时压缩功能,以提高SSD的性能和寿命。
“`
sudo btrfs filesystem defragment -r -f /mnt/ssd
“`
其中,`/mnt/ssd`是您的SSD挂载点路径。4. 监控SSD健康状态
为了及时了解SSD的健康状况,可以使用以下命令来监控SSD的健康状态。
“`
sudo smartctl -a /dev/sdX
“`5. 启用SSD缓存
如果您的系统同时配备了SSD和HDD,可以通过以下命令将SSD用作缓存来加速磁盘访问。
“`
sudo dmcache_load -u cache_uuid cache_device backing_device
“`
其中,`cache_uuid`是缓存设备的UUID,`cache_device`是SSD设备路径,`backing_device`是HDD设备路径。详细的操作流程请参考相关文档。综上所述,上述是一些与SSD相关的常用Linux命令和操作流程,用于管理和优化SSD的使用。根据您的具体需求和系统配置,可以选择相应的命令和方法。
2年前